The latest national statistics on Post-16 Further Education produced by the The Data Service in consultation with BIS and DCSF statisticians were released on 18th December 2008 according to the arrangements approved by the UK Statistics AuthorityUK Statistics Authority

DIUS: Post-16 Education: Learner Participation and Outcomes in England 2007/08

DescriptionStatistics on Post-16 Further Education are published as 'Post-16 Education: Learner participation and outcomes in England 2007/08' and include data from the whole of England.

The latest statistics report on the academic years from 2005/06 to 2007/08 and update those previously released on 22nd May 2008 and 10th April 2008.

Key Points:
    Young People (16 - 18 year olds)
  • The total volume of young people participating in LSC-funded Further Education (including through FE organisations and WBL, but excluding school sixth forms) is 1,026,500. This is an increase of 2.3 per cent on 2006/07.
  • 135,000 young people achieved full level 2 qualifications in the 2007/08 academic year. This is an increase of 2.7 per cent from 2006/07.
  • 158,300 young people achieved full level 3 qualifications in the 2007/08 academic year. This is an increase of 7.2 per cent from 2006/07.

  • Adults (19 year olds and older)
  • 299,000 adults achieved full level 2 qualifications in the 2007/08 academic year. This is an increase of 44.6 per cent from 2006/07.
  • 127,900 adults achieved full level 3 qualifications in the 2007/08 academic year. This is an increase of 14.2 per cent from 2006/07.
  • The total volume of adults participating in LSC-funded Further Education (including through FE organisations, WBL, TtG and ASL, but excluding Higher Education) is 3,095,400.

  • Apprenticeships
  • Apprenticeship starts have increased from 184,400 in 2006/07 to 224,800 in 2007/08, a rise of 21.9%.
  • Apprenticeship completions have increased from 111,800 in 2006/07 to 112,600 in 2007/08, an overall rise of 0.7%.
  • The overall apprenticeship completion rate has increased from 58.9 0n 2006/07 to 63.7 0n 2007/08.

  • Train to Gain
  • The number of Train to Gain starts in 2007/08 was 331,800, a new high. 169,200 adults achieved a TtG qualification in 2007/08.


Update 29th December 2008 It has been necessary to revise the Statistical First Release as published on 18th December. The revisions made for data relating to 2006/7 and 2007/8 are to correct an inconsistency in the methodology used in breakdowns for the category 'Below Level 2 (excluding Skills for Life)' as presented in tables 1 and 3 to 6. These changes lead to downward revisions for this category but does not affect the total learner numbers.
